About Truck Governors

As their name suggests, truck governors are built to govern a truck’s speed. In short, they won’t allow your truck to exceed certain speeds. Even if you press your foot down on the gas pedal, your vehicle’s speed won’t go above a particular limit set in the truck governor.

Most trucking companies have installed truck governors in their vehicles. The governors in these vehicles are designed to prevent their drivers from exceeding certain speeds, thus helping to reduce accidents.

How Truck Governors Work

As mentioned above, truck governors prevent trucks from traveling beyond certain speeds. There are different types of speed limiters on the market. And the mode of operation will vary from one governor to the next. However, electronically controlled governors are currently the most popular.

Electronic governors are usually connected to the truck’s electronic control module (ECM) or control box. You can only modify these governors using specialized computer equipment. Hence, it’s almost impossible for a driver to tamper with the governor.

So, how do these electronic governors work? Well, the governor on the control box will receive a signal from the truck’s wheel speed sensors or transmission differential. The governor will then shut off pulses to the ignition or fuel injectors when the truck exceeds the set maximum speed.

These pulses will only open when the truck’s speed is lowered to the appropriate level. In short, the governor will prevent excess fuel from reaching the truck’s engine. Hence, even if you keep pushing on the accelerator pedal, the truck won’t exceed the maximum set speed.

Most of the major trucking companies in the U.S have installed governors in their trucks. These governors are designed to ensure the drivers using the trucks will always maintain safe and legal driving speeds. The maximum speed set on the governor will vary from one truck to the other. But in most cases, the speeds are usually set at 65mph, 68mph and 70mph.

Pros of Governors in Trucks

Almost every trucking company these days has installed electronic governors on their fleet. In fact, it will be hard to find a trucking company whose fleet doesn’t have governors. Here are some of the benefits of governors in trucks.

Reduced Accidents

One of the main advantages of governors in trucks is that they can help to reduce the occurrence of fatal crashes. Speed is arguably the primary cause of the majority of fatal crashes. Hence, reducing a truck’s speed can considerably help to lower the number of fatal crashes.

According to a study carried out by the Federal Motor Carrier Safety Administration (FMCSA), trucks that have been outfitted with speed limiters or governors have a 50% lower crash rate as compared to those that don’t have.

If a truck is fitted with a speed limiter, the driver will always maintain slow and safe driving speeds. And when a driver is driving at a slower speed, they can clearly see what’s ahead of them. Furthermore, they will have adequate time to react and stop the vehicle, in case there’s an emergency in front of them.

On the other hand, if a truck doesn’t have a speed governor, they may be tempted to drive at higher speeds. Consequently, it will be hard for them to react on time whenever there’s an accident ahead of them, leading to a fatal crash.

Furthermore, trucks take a longer distance to stop, compared to passenger vehicles. On average, a truck moving at 65mph will take around 525 feet to stop compared to 316 feet for a passenger vehicle moving at the same speed.

So, if the truck happened to be traveling at higher speeds, it will take even a long distance to stop, meaning a fatal crash will be unavoidable, in an emergency. Hence, installing speed governors on trucks can reduce fatal clashes considerably. And when combined with various accident mitigation technologies on trucks, speed governors can help to lessen the severity of fatal clashes or prevent them altogether.

Lower Fuel Costs

Driving a truck at a higher speed will consume more fuel, compared to driving at slower speeds. Whenever you push your vehicle to its limits, you will force it to work harder. Consequently, it will burn more fuel. Hence, installing a speed limiter on a truck can help to reduce fuel costs.

According to a report published by the U.S Department of Energy, reducing driving speeds by around 5mph to 10mph can improve fuel efficiency by approximately 7% to 14% respectively.

And considering that trucking companies want to maintain a healthy bottom line, installing speed limiters in their trucks can help in reducing fuel consumption. Consequently, this can help to reduce the amount of money spent on fuel. As a result, their profit margins will be higher.

Lower Emissions

As mentioned above, the faster you drive, the more fuel you will burn. And the more fuel you are burning, the higher the quantity of carbon dioxide and other harmful gases the truck will emit.

Installing a speed governor on a truck will prevent it from driving at above-average speeds. At the same time, the fuel burnt by the truck will be lower, resulting in lesser emissions of harmful gases to the atmosphere.

Lesser Repair and Replacement Costs

Driving at higher speeds may lead to serious crashes. And when this happens, the truck may end up incurring serious damage, which may need thousands of dollars to fix. Also, the truck may end up being totaled, meaning it will have to be replaced.

The problem is that if the crash happened as a result of the truck driver’s fault, the insurance company will not handle the repairs or replacement. In this case, the trucking company will have to handle everything. And if such issues happen frequently, the repair or replacement costs can eat into their profit margins.

By installing truck governors, the driver will be forced to drive at slower and steadier speeds, thus reducing clashes. And if a clash was to occur due to the driver’s fault, the damage will not be extensive. Hence, installing speed governors can help to reduce the money spent on truck replacement or repairs.
